Struct DistanceComputer 

Source
pub struct DistanceComputer<A = GlobalAllocator>
where A: AllocatorCore,
{ /* private fields */ }
Expand description

An opaque DistanceFunction for the Quantizer trait object.

§Note

Left-hand arguments must be Opaque slices compressed using Quantizer::compress_query using Self::layout.

Right-hand arguments must be Opaque slices compressed using Quantizer::compress.

Otherwise, distance computations may return garbage values or panic.
